29 March 2023

 


There were forty starters in tonight’s Broulee run.  We welcomed Chloe Fisher, a visitor from Ballina and Rob Kellett, a Broulee resident to their first run with the group.  Tonight, was the last of the Day Light saving start time and next week we will revert back to 4-30 PM start.

 

We were fortunate to have some of the athletes, who competed in various events last weekend.  In the Triathlon Steve Phipps was 2nd in his age group and Jenny Taylor was 6th in her age group.  In the Half Marathon Matt Lambert was 9th overall and Mike Lambert was 3rd in his age group.  In the 10 kilometres Bernie Lambert was 1st in her age group.  We congratulate all our Broulee runners who participated in the various events.

 

Personal best times in the 2-kilometers tonight were recorded by Harper Bourke (by 34 seconds), Violet Turner (by 20 seconds), Annie Johnsen (by 33 seconds), and Jennifer Tangney (47 seconds).  In the 4 kilometres PBs were recorded by Stephen Seidel (by 22 seconds), and Brad Turner (by 14 seconds) and Andrew Greenway (by 6 seconds).
